How do you place a workshop anywhere in Fallout 4?
So if anyone on PC wants to try it, you go into the console and type console key , then “player. placeatme c1aeb” . This spawns a workbench under you. The bench will not spawn flat, usually, it will be tilted.

Can you build anywhere in Fallout 4?
You can’t build everywhere and you are not joining the settlements – you establish settlements mainly from zero or several settlers. You are limited to build only inside green area at the place where workshop is located.

How do you transfer items from one settlement to another in Fallout 4?
Open the Workshop menu and walk up to the settler you want to move. Move command should show up in the bottom command menu. Once you press it you will get a list of available settlements and the settler will go there. Just make sure you have enough resources at the target settlement to support new population.

How do you get to the top of the Corvega assembly plant?
To reach it, you’ll need to climb the numerous catwalks which span above the outside of the plant toward the huge blue sphere perched atop the facility. A lone raider guards the top of a red tower on the East side of the plant, which has an explosive box and chems on the top.

How do I get my stored items back in Fallout 4?
Any stored items should be available in the regular build-mode. It isn’t very obvious, but as an example, if you’ve stored your generator and you try to build another generator, a tiny “1” should be visible over the generator icon, indicating that you have one stored that’ll be used if you build it.
Do workbenches share inventory Fallout 4?
Without a supply line, especially in regards to crafting stations at locations you do not own, items are only shared between the local crafting stations. In other words, the armor workbench will share with the weapon workbench in that area, but not with Sanctuary or any other location.
